Dhaka, Aug 05 (V7N) - In light of the ongoing situation in Bangladesh, Nahid Islam, a prominent figure in the Anti-Discrimination Student Movement, has urged students and locals to protect the nation’s assets from potential looters.

In an evening interview with Channel 24, Nahid stressed the need for vigilance. "We must safeguard our state property and prevent any looting attempts during this time," he said.

Nahid, along with eight other coordinators, has called for peaceful demonstrations while urging participants to thwart any looting efforts. The group also advocates for the establishment of an interim government comprising students, teachers, and civil society members, with the goal of eventually transitioning power to elected representatives.
